They'll be back! Rob Kardashian and Blac Chyna's reality TV spinoff is renewed for second season... one month after they welcome Dream

Rob Kardashian and Blac Chyna's reality TV show has been renewed for a second season.

The celebrity duo will return to TV screens in 2017, when they will star in an eight-episode series of Rob & Chyna, which will give fans a behind-the-scenes look into their turbulent love life.

'Rob and Chyna's romance struck such a chord with our viewers, who were engaged in their story even before we started filming the first season,' Jeff Olde, executive vice-president of programming and development at E!, said to The Hollywood Reporter. 'We are excited to share the next chapter of their story.'

The first season of Rob & Chyna was a major success in the US. The show followed the couple as they prepared for the birth of their first child and lifted the lid on their much-discussed relationship.

Filming the show was a major departure from what had previously been a very reclusive lifestyle for 29-year-old Rob.

Rob and Chyna, 28, - whose daughter, Dream, was born in November - are currently living in a lavish mansion owned by Kylie Jenner, Rob's half-sister.

But the family ties don't quite end there. Kylie, 19, is romantically linked to rapper Tyga, 27, whose legal name is Michael Ray Nguyen-Stevenson. Tyga is the father of Blac Chyna's first child, King Cairo Stevenson, age four. 

Rob, his fiancée and their newborn daughter Dream moved into Kylie's Hidden Hills mansion this week in order to be closer to Rob's family.

The couple, who have been dating since January and announced their engagement via Instagram after three months together, had initially planned to live in Chyna's home in Tarzana, but ultimately decided on Kylie's sprawling seven-bedroom house.
